Abstract:
This paper considers the construction of cryptographic $S$-boxes of the length $N=3^k$,
which are optimal from the point of view of the absence of correlation between the output and input vectors. Constructed sets of $S$-boxes can be recommended for upgrading of the existing block symmetric ciphers, as well as for the synthesis of new high-speed encryption algorithms based on the principles of multi-valued logic.
